How much do assistant to event planner j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ant to event planner in Santa Rosa, CA is $22.52,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.12 and $25.77 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ant to event planner do?

An Assistant to Event Planner supports the event planner in organizing and executing various events such as weddings, corporate meetings, and parties. Their duties typically include handling administrative tasks, coordinating with vendors, managing schedules, assisting with event setup and breakdown, and ensuring everything runs smoothly on the day of the event. They play a crucial role in keeping the planning process organized and efficient, often acting as a liaison between the planner, clients, and event staff. This role requires strong organizational, communication, and multitasking sk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ant to event planner,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ant to Event Planner,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and a background in event planning or hospitality. Familiarity with event management software, budgeting tools, and office productivity suites is often required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and multitasking skills help you effectively support planners and interact with vendors and clients. These skills are crucial for ensuring seamless event execution and maintaining client satisfaction in a dynamic, deadline-driven environment.

What are some typical challenges an assistant to event planner might face during the event planning process?

As an Assistant to Event Planner, you may encounter challenges such as managing last-minute changes, coordinating with multiple vendors, and ensuring all event details align with client expectations. It’s common to juggle several tasks simultaneously, from tracking RSVP lists to handling logistics on event day. Strong organizational skills and adaptability are crucial, as you’ll often need to resolve unforeseen issues quickly while maintaining clear communication with the lead planner and the rest of the team.

What is the difference between Assistant To Event Planner vs Event Coordinator?

AspectAssistant To Event PlannerEvent Coordinator
ResponsibilitiesSupports planning tasks, manages schedules, handles logisticsOversees event execution, manages vendors, ensures smooth operations
Required SkillsOrganizational skills, communication, multitaskingLeadership, problem-solving, vendor management
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, event planning teamsOn-site during events, coordination with vendors and clients
Typical EmployersEvent planning firms, corporate event departmentsEvent venues, corporate event teams, wedding planners

While both roles support event planning, an Assistant To Event Planner primarily provides administrative and logistical support, whereas an Event Coordinator manages the actual event execution on-site. The roles often overlap but differ in scope and responsibilities.

How to become an assistant to an event planner?

To become an assistant to an event planner, candidates typically need strong organizational and communication skills, experience in event coordination or customer service, and proficiency with planning tools like spreadsheets or event management software. Gaining relevant experience through internships or entry-level roles can improve chances, and a high school diploma or equivalent is usually required; some positions may prefer a college degree in hospitality, marketing, or related fields.

Job description

Summary:
At Hyatt, we believe our guests choose us because of our caring, attentive associates who are committed to providing efficient service and awe-inspiring, meaningful experiences that nourish the soul and elevate wellbeing.
The Event Planning Manager is responsible for upselling and servicing events. Primary sales efforts are in banquet food and beverage and venue rental and includes menu planning, agenda setting, and resort event services. Duties also include contract review and facilitating communication before, during, and post event with pertinent resort team members to ensure a high level of service.
The pay range Alila Napa Valley reasonably expects to pay for this position is $75,000 to $85,000 annually. Decisions regarding individual salaries will be based on a number of factors including experience.

Responsibilities include, but not limited to:
  • Conduct in person and virtual site inspections for definite groups
  • Maintaining well organized documentation and reports in Hyatt systems
  • Working as a team member with the sales and events staff and other support staff
  • Plan, arrange, organize, and diagram events with the goal of meeting or exceeding client/customer expectations and setting up the operational team for success
  • Prioritize tasks and independently manage workflow based on appropriate needs and demands and the department's policy and procedures
  • Clearly communicate policies, procedures, and services offered by the resort with clients/customers
  • Communicate applicable Hyatt standard operating procedures (SOPs) for events to Event Services and Culinary leaders and become the liason between the sales contracting process and event execution
  • Coordinate and communicate event logistics with other departments to meet or exceed client/customer expectations, through Hyatt's property management software
  • Monitor on-site event activities to ensure satisfaction of participants and follow up with any resolutions provided by operations to ensure resolution of customer service issues and concerns prior to group departure.
  • Manage Meeting Planner portal defaults for resort and promote usage
  • Manager work schedule to strategically be on-site during critical event times (greetings, breaks, departures, etc) as needed
  • Present daily bill to client/customer through Hyatt Meeting Planner portal or in person, at client/customer's preference
  • Reconcile final invoices with Finance department, and client/customer, with assistance from shared billing services
  • Additional duties as determined by Director of Sales, Marketing, and Events
  • Attend event order meetings, Sales/Event team meetings, Sales/Marketing meetings as requested
  • Prepare and be prepared to lead Weekly Group Resume meetings for the resort's groups
  • Meet or exceed annual revenue and service goals
Qualifications:
  • High attention to detail required
  • Able to work weekends and evenings as required
  • Two years of office environment experience required
  • 1-2 years of Event Planning Manager or Event Planning Coordinator experience preferred
  • Self-motivated and understand Hyatt's core purpose of care
  • Possess the ability to prioritize tasks and work well within a team environment
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office including Work, Excel, PowerPoint, and property management system
Physical requirements
  • Ability to sit for extended periods while performing administrative tasks
  • Occasional standing, walking, and lifting up to 20 pounds for event materials or meeting setups
  • Must be able to work a flexible schedule, with occasional evening or weekend shifts as needed to support specific events
